Is this factory----your mother once worked.

问题描述:

Is this factory____your mother once worked.
答案是where 可是为什么不能用in which (注:选项中有in which 但是没有选这个)
1个回答 分类:英语 2014-12-06

问题解答:

我来补答
如果这个地方factory 前面有一个定冠词the,则可以用in which
这个地方如果用陈述语序,则应该是:this factory is where you mother once worked.where引导的是表语从句,不能用 in which替换,而加上the以后,则结构发生变化,this is the factory where your mother once worked. this做主语,the factory作为表语,where引导的从句作为关系副词引导的定语从句,此时就可以用in which 替换where了.
需要提醒注意的是,只有在定语从句中, 才能用in which或者at which 替换where这个引导词.
不懂请继续追问.
 
 
展开全文阅读
剩余:2000